A brief note from Kendra:
Our precious baby boy Norris. 6 months along in the womb as he prepares to make his entrance into this world in a few short months. I haven’t shared this news online yet, and sadly this is not the way we imagined doing it either.
In the past week our sweet boy has received the diagnosis of congenital heart disease. His heart, specifically the right side, has not formed as it should. The human body is amazing though and that tiny heart continues to pump away with all it’s might.
Doctors are very hopeful we’ll meet him on the other side of the womb, although his battle after is likely going to be a difficult one. He will face heart surgery or procedures within days of birth and likely multiple in his life to follow.
Obviously our hearts are heavy. We have moments where the fears and tears won‘t stop coming, and other moments full of hope and pushing forward to fight for our boy in any way we know how. For some it might seem like a strange thing to say in a time like this, but we continue to go back to the truth we believe, that God is good. A specific phrase we feel marks his life, no matter how long or short that life may be.
We are beyond thankful for all who are walking with us on this journey, as it just begins. We couldn’t do it without you... and we’re hopeful for our boy to know and love you one day as much as we do.
